The cap will not change the sound of the PU. It just effects the curve of the roll off, full open and full closed are the same for all tone controls, it's just how much at different increments that changes.

I assume you want a more well-rounded response. The JB is really hot, the '59 is like a PAF. Duncan has a ton of info on his site that lets you compare pickups and hear sound clips. If you like the '59 neck pup, you may just need a 59 for the bridge. I'm happy with mine.
